Genco - Easy Aces - Bradford. PA
Since I know the G-Man AKA Glen has a weakness for cracked ice scales I called and dubbed this one the GLen'co - Easy aces.
This one cleaned up extremely well and turned out close to perfect. The tang had some patches of bluing left but it just looked horrible so off it went. The scales didn't look all that healthy either so they were treated with all my voodoo tricks and are now a mirror shine example.
I still need to hone her up and give this puppy a shave but I can already tell she won't dissapoint. No matter what but there's just something about those cracked ice scales that radiate classy, retro and gorgeous looks.
The Genco Co.
Bradford. PA.
Grind: Full Hollow
Blade width: 11/16
Total weight: 1.3 oz
Blade cutting edge: 2.6 inches
